Just yesterday a research paper was released about a site near Tallahassee, in that case a water filled sinkhole.

They found bison and mastodon bones that dated to 14,500 and showed clear signs of human butchering.

I grew up in Florida, and I can't recall ever being taught that large grazing animals once roamed the state. In fact, modern day Florida really has nothing that resembles large dry ground grasslands, so it's hard to understand what a bison could have survived on, especially in the Vero Beach area.

The cool thing about the Tallahassee site is that the 14,500 year date plays havoc with the consensus idea that Clovis people were the first to inhabit the Lower 48
